AutoGen Agent Manager - TUI Application
Project Overview
A Terminal User Interface (TUI) application for dynamically creating, managing, and interacting with AutoGen AI agents. The application provides a visual interface for configuring agents with custom parameters, assigning tasks, and viewing results in real-time.

Database Schema
Table: agents
id- INTEGER PRIMARY KEYname- TEXT UNIQUE NOT NULLsystem_message- TEXT NOT NULLmodel- TEXT NOT NULLstreaming- BOOLEAN DEFAULT FALSEtools_enabled- BOOLEAN DEFAULT FALSEtemperature- REAL DEFAULT 1.0max_tokens- INTEGER NULLcreated_at- TIMESTAMPupdated_at- TIMESTAMP
Table: tools
id- INTEGER PRIMARY KEYname- TEXT UNIQUE NOT NULLdescription- TEXTimplementation- TEXT NOT NULLenabled- BOOLEAN DEFAULT TRUEcreated_at- TIMESTAMP
Table: agent_tools (Many-to-Many)
agent_id- INTEGER FOREIGN KEYtool_id- INTEGER FOREIGN KEY- PRIMARY KEY (agent_id, tool_id)
Table: task_history
id- INTEGER PRIMARY KEYagent_id- INTEGER FOREIGN KEYtask- TEXT NOT NULLresult- TEXTtokens_used- INTEGERexecution_time- REALstatus- TEXT (success/error/cancelled)created_at- TIMESTAMP

Error Handling
Categories
- Input Validation Errors - Invalid user input
- Model Errors - API failures, rate limits
- Database Errors - Connection issues, constraint violations
- Tool Execution Errors - Runtime failures in tools
- UI Errors - Rendering or interaction issues
Strategy
- Use try-except blocks with specific exception types
- Log all errors with context
- Show user-friendly error messages in UI
- Provide recovery options when possible
- Never expose sensitive information in errors

Security Guidelines
- Never store API keys in database
- Use environment variables for secrets
- Sanitize all user inputs
- Validate tool code before execution
- Implement rate limiting for task execution
- Log security-relevant events
- Regular dependency updates
